【call的短语】在英语学习中,“call”是一个非常常见的动词,它不仅有“打电话”的基本含义,还常与其他词搭配形成丰富的短语动词。掌握这些“call”的短语,有助于提升语言表达的准确性和自然度。以下是一些常见且实用的“call”短语及其用法总结。
一、常见“call”的短语总结
短语 | 含义 | 例句 |
call back | 回电话;回访 | I called him back, but he wasn't at home. |
call for | 需要;要求;呼吁 | The project calls for more resources. |
call in | 叫来;请来(某人) | We called in a specialist to fix the problem. |
call off | 取消;停止 | They called off the meeting due to bad weather. |
call on | 访问;拜访;呼吁 | She called on her old friend last week. |
call out | 大声叫喊;召唤;指出 | He called out the name of the suspect. |
call up | 打电话;征召(入伍) | I called up my sister and told her the news. |
call it a day | 结束一天的工作 | It's time to call it a day. |
